Hendo on Injury Problems
It’s been a tough season for Liverpool captain Jordan Henderson. After a stellar 2014/15 and a good start to 2015/16 that included an assist against Bournemouth, he was struck down with a heel injury known as plantar fasciitis, an injury that affects ligaments in the sole of your foot. The injury kept him out for over 3 months and since his return he’s shown glimpses of the player he was last season that won so many admirers but has also been hampered by his injury throughout, drawing much scrutiny from impatient fans looking for him to be at Gerrard level.
Despite undergoing a number of experimental treatments, including flying out to America for a series of injections, there’s not much the skipper can do to heal the injury properly until it ruptures totally. “Sometimes I can be my own worst enemy if I’m playing with an injury or different things,” said Hendo. “It’s my own fault at times but that’s just the way I am. I want to play football, I want to try to put myself out for the team. I feel as though now I’m starting to get back to the physicality – that’s a big part of my game – and when that’s correct then everything else seems to flow much better.”
“When I was away with England I think I put in one of my highest performances of the season in terms of the physical side of the game which was pleasing for me. I got confidence from that and I just need to continue to work instead of trying to play catch up all the time.”
Henderson is correct that he put in a better performance for England, thankfully for us he followed it up with another very good 90 against Tottenham on Saturday and the skipper now feels he’s learning to cope with the injury better and that it’s not restricting his mobility quite as badly. “It’s not an issue. After games it still gets a bit sore but it’s much better than how it was,” he added positively.
“That’s pleasing for me. I am out there, I’m playing and I can manage it. When it completely goes will be whenever I have a rest but I’m not sure if I’ll have one of them any time soon. Maybe if I go to the Euros I’ll have some time off after that and then after the rest hopefully it will have completely settled. Until then I just have to manage it. I felt good against Spurs and I feel better physically all the time and I’m getting back to where I want to be.”
